php创建数组有哪些方法
在PHP中,可以使用以下方法创建数组: 使用array()函数创建数组: $array = array(); // 空数组 $array = array(1, 2, 3); // 索引数组 $array = array("key1" => "value1", "key2" => "value2"); // 关联数组 使用[]语法糖创建数组(PHP 5.4及以上版本): $array = []; // 空数...
PHP中传值与传引用的区别
PHP中传值与传引用的区别:1.传值要重新构造一份原参数的拷贝,而传引用则不需要。2.传值改变变量值的大小,都不会影响到函数外边的变量值,而传引用对值的任何改变,在函数外部也有所体现。3.传值对参数的修改不会改变原参数,而传引用时可以直接修改原参数。...
PHP常量的声明方式有哪些
在PHP中声明常量的方法有以下几种1.使用const函数声明常量class CL{ //定义常量 const CLS = '常量值'; function a(){ //调用常量方法 echo self::CLS; } } (new CL)->a();2.使用define函数声明常量define('CL',10);echo CL;//判断常量是否存在if(defined('CL')){echo 'ture'; }e...
学php需要什么基础
学php需要的基础有:1.php基本的语法。2.php框架以及CMS。3.mysql数据库设计表。4.mysql数据库的基本SQL语句。5.了解变量的类型,语法,函数,基本逻辑等。6.了解并学习html+css+js。...
php怎么转换成txt
php转换为txt的方法:1、双击此电脑,找到查看。2:找到文件扩展名。3:重命名php文件后缀。具体操作步骤:第一步:双击此电脑,找到查看并点击。第二步:找到文件扩展名并勾选。第三步;右键php文件点击重命名,把文件后缀php改为txt。...
php如何删除数据库一条信息
php删除数据库一条信息的方法:1、连接数据库并检测连接;2、连接成功通过执行sql语句删除即可。具体操作步骤:1、首先连接数据库,测试是否连接数据库成功。2、连接成功后,通过执行sql语句删除即可。示例代码如下:$con=mysqli_connect("localhost","username","password","database");//检测连接if(mysqli_connect_errno()){echo"...
php如何遍历目录
在php中遍历目录的方法1.使用glob()函数遍历目录function getfiles($path){foreach(glob($path) as $afile){if(is_dir($afile)){ getfiles($afile.'/*'); } else { echo $afile.''; }}} getfiles(__DIR__);2.使用foreach循环遍历目录function myscandir($...
什么是php
PHP是开源脚本语言,中文名为超文本预处理器,主要适用于Web开发领域,随着移动应用的兴起,PHP也可用于开发API接口,它吸收了C语言、Java和Perl的特点,几乎支持所有流行的数据库以及操作系统,所有的CGI的功能PHP都能实现,是当今热门的网站程序开发语言。...
php如何求数组中的最大值
在php中利用for循环求出数组中的最大值,具体方法如下:1.首先,新建一个php项目文件;2.php项目文件新建好后,在文件中定义一个数组,并将数组赋值给一个变量;$arr = array(1,5,6,8,9);$max = $arr[0];3.最后,数组定义好后,使用for循环即可求出数组中的最大值;$arr = array(1,5,6,8,9);$max = $arr[0];for($i=0;$i$max[$i]...
php搜索功能如何实现
实现PHP搜索功能的一种常见方法是使用SQL查询语句来从数据库中检索数据。以下是一个示例代码,展示了如何在PHP中实现基本的搜索功能: <?php // 连接到数据库 $servername = "localhost"; $username = "username"; $password = "password"; $dbname = "database"; $conn = new mysqli($servern...
php设置编码为utf8的方法是什么
在PHP中设置编码为UTF-8的方法如下: 在代码文件的开头添加以下代码: header('Content-Type: text/html; charset=utf-8'); 在连接到数据库之前,执行以下代码: mysqli_set_charset($conn, "utf8"); 其中,$conn 是数据库连接对象。 在数据库查询之前,执行以下代码: mysqli_query($conn, "SET NAMES '...
php工厂模式怎么应用
PHP工厂模式是一种创建对象的设计模式,它通过工厂类来创建对象,而不是直接在代码中实例化对象。它可以将对象的创建和使用分离,提高代码的灵活性和可维护性。 下面是一个简单的示例,演示了如何在PHP中应用工厂模式: // 创建一个接口,定义要创建的对象的方法 interface Animal { public function sound(); } // 创建实现接口的具体类 class Dog implements An...
php中Snoopy类的用法有哪些
Snoopy类是一个用于HTTP请求和抓取网页内容的PHP库。以下是Snoopy类的一些常见用法: 发送GET请求: include_once('Snoopy.class.php'); $snoopy = new Snoopy; $snoopy->fetch('http://example.com'); $result = $snoopy->results; echo $result; 发送POST请求:...
php登录成功后跳转页面的方法是什么
在PHP中,登录成功后跳转页面的方法是使用header()函数来实现重定向。 下面是一个示例代码,用于在登录成功后跳转到另一个页面: <?php // 检查用户名和密码是否正确 if ($username === "admin" && $password === "password") { // 登录成功,跳转到另一个页面 header("Location: dashboard.php"); ex...
php计划任务定时执行怎么实现
在PHP中,可以使用计划任务(Cron Job)来定时执行任务。以下是实现计划任务的步骤: 创建一个 PHP 脚本,该脚本包含要定时执行的任务代码。 在服务器上设置计划任务。具体的设置方法取决于你使用的操作系统和服务器环境。一般来说,可以通过以下几种方式设置计划任务: 使用 cPanel 或其他服务器管理面板提供的计划任务工具。 使用操作系统的计划任务工具,如在 Linux 上使用 crontab 命令。...
